In this episode of Catholic Girl on the Radio, we dive into the moment Jesus wept over Jerusalem (Luke 19:41) and what it reveals about His heart for each of us. His tears weren’t just for a city—they were for every person who struggles to recognize the peace He offers.
We’ll explore the writings of early Church Fathers like Cyril of Alexandria and Eusebius of Caesarea to uncover how this moment in Scripture speaks directly to our lives today. What happens when we reject God’s call? How does His mercy and foreknowledge continue to guide us, even when we go astray?
Through this reflection, we’ll see how Jesus’ compassion for Jerusalem mirrors His love for each of us, and how we can open our hearts to the peace He still offers. If you’ve ever felt distant from God or unsure of how to respond to His call, this episode is for you.
